Arsenal sporting director Andrea Berta has identified Jurrien Timber and Declan Rice as his next contract priorities after securing Bukayo Saka’s agreement to a new deal until June 2031. The club understands that extending both players’ stays represents crucial business following Berta’s successful negotiations with Saka, Ethan Nwaneri, Myles Lewis-Skelly, William Saliba and Gabriel Magalhaes earlier this season.

Berta Targets Timber and Rice Extensions After Securing Saka Until 2031

Arsenal are keen to extend Timber’s stay at the Emirates Stadium despite the 24-year-old defender having two-and-a-half years remaining on his current deal. The Netherlands international joined from Ajax for £34 million during summer 2023 on a five-year contract but has established himself as a key player in Mikel Arteta’s side after recovering from a debut campaign injury setback.

The club also want to tie Rice down to a new deal following his impressive performances since arriving from West Ham for £100 million plus £5 million in add-ons in summer 2023. The 26-year-old midfielder signed a five-year contract with an option for a further 12 months and has featured in all but four Premier League fixtures since his move, contributing 15 goals and 21 assists across all competitions.

Rice has become a stalwart in Arteta’s midfield alongside his defensive versatility, while Timber’s recovery from injury has seen him emerge as a crucial component of Arsenal’s backline. Both players represent significant investments that the club want to protect with improved terms, following the successful model established with other key squad members this season.

Six Arsenal players in total could be in line for contract extensions once Saka’s deal is finalized, with Gabriel Martinelli, Gabriel Jesus, Christian Norgaard and Leandro Trossard all entering the final 18 months of their current agreements. However, Berta has prioritized Timber and Rice as the most pressing cases given their importance to Arteta’s tactical system and their status as key performers since joining the club.
